Default The 70s

Can you remember any of this? If you can, tell me more!



1970

Sir Jimmy Saville hosts an explosion of small skirts, pythons and festival fever.


1971

Britt Ekland looks back at big shoes, tough guys, cuddly toys and the fastest milkman in the West.


1972

David Cassidy recalls roller skates, Cosmo and Osmond-mania.


1973

Noddy Holder presents David Bowie, Chopper Bikes and Roger Moore.


1974

Roobarb and Custard present the year Bagpuss was born.


1975

Sweeney, Monopoly, and glasses for dogs.


1976

Kermit the Frog remembers Abba, Rocky, and Beards.


1977

Carrie Fisher remembers the year Star Wars was released.


1978

Lynda Carter was a Wonderful Woman in 1978


1979

Bo Derek introduces the final year of a funky decade.
